Is Hospice Care A Suitable Decision For End Stage Liver Cirrhosis, Severe Ascites, Encephalopathy, And Unstable Blood Sugar?

My husband is at end stage liver cirrhosis. He has been in the hospital 5 times in 5 months. He had encephalopathy and had to go through all the harsh treatments. He also has diabetes that was getting over 600 now we have to watch it because it will get around 43 at times. He has ascites really bad and has had paracentesis several times. He now has a denver shunt but it can t keep up so more paracentesis was needed. He was falling a lot while I was working. He had to have stitches because of that. He started having seizures but we think it may be from the sugar being so low. Well we decided to put him on hospice and I just hope we made the right decision.
